Goozle Posted August 29, 2004 Share Posted August 29, 2004 Not sure if this is in the right area.. but does anyone know how to clear the email addresses or usernames that sometimes find their way to being stored in the .Net Messenger Service box thingy. Here's a picture of what I'm on about :I have a bunch of them, that I want to clear and don't know where to find them or if it's possible to clear it.Any suggestions?.. tlatoani Posted August 29, 2004 Share Posted August 29, 2004 Well, if you are using Win XP it's easy:Start ---> Control Panel ---> User's Accounts ---> (select Admin account or your main account) in the left list choose "Manage my passwords" (or something like that), a window with your passwords will pop up, now you can delete as many as you want.The menus could be different because my OS is in spanish.
